Try us on those famous quality Milady and Russell Roses, Chrysanthemums, Pompons, etc. Paul Kling-sporn, manag-er of the Chicago Flower Growers' Association, A. Bensen, of the Lombard Floral Co., and Fred Stielow, of Stielow Bros. Co., visited the growers at Richmond, Ind., November 3, where Hill's novelty rose. Premier, was the center of attraction. Mr. Bensen and Mr. Stielow liked the variety so well after they inspected it growing, that they placed good-sized orders for stock immediately. Tom Kidwell, son of J. F. Kidwell, who was with the 108th Engineers in France, has been ordered back to this country to take up special training at West Point. He is one of the many men in the trade who is making good, and it is a pleasure to note that the florists are easily holding their own in making the world safe for democracy.
